  • Patent number: 5744863
    Abstract: An aluminum or copper heat sink is attached to a ceramic cap or exposed semiconductor chip using flexible-epoxy to provide improved thermal performance. The aluminum may be coated by anodizing or chromate conversion or the copper may be coated with nickel. Such structures are especilly useful for CQFP, CBGA, CCGA, CPGA, TBGA, PBGA, DCAM, MCM-L, single layer ceramic, and other chip carrier packages as well as for flip chip attachment to flexible or rigid organic circuit boards. These adhesive materials withstand thermal cycle tests of 0.degree. to 100.degree. C. for 1,500 cycles, -25.degree. to 125.degree. C. for 400 cycles, and -40.degree. to 140.degree. C. for 300 cycles; and withstand continuous exposure at 130.degree. C. for 1000 hours without loss of strength. Flexible-epoxies have a modulus of elasticity below 100,000 psi and a glass transition temperature below 25.degree. C., are much stronger than typical silicone adhesives, and do not contaminate the module or circuit board with silicone.

    Abstract: The design, creation, organization, and playing of multimedia stories is accomplished by first defining a story with episodes scheduled on a temporal layout. The organization of the story episodes is then separated into two parts: (1) a temporal organization of story episodes using temporal cliques, and (2) a spatial organization which spatially organizes the members of each temporal clique independently of the members of other temporal cliques. A complicated multimedia problem that exists in time and space is reduced to a number of smaller problems that exist only in space. Stories that are organized according this way can be related by a directed graph into a hyperstory. Using the directed graph, different stories in the hyperstory can be played by satisfying defined asynchronous conditions. The conditions are used in the graph to define the relationships among the stories in the graph.

    Abstract: Temperature gradients between a ceramic substrate of high thermal conductivity and the braze materials used to attach a metallic device such as a cap are reduced by using an embedded internal heat source in the substrate to minimize the thermal gradient, thereby minimizing the stresses that can result in substrate cracking when a cap is brazed onto the substrate.

    Abstract: A train separation detector for a distributed power control system in railroad trains uses the distance traveled input from an axle drive generator or similar device to compute the speed of the lead locomotive and the speed of the remote locomotives and also the distance traveled by the lead locomotive and the remote locomotives per unit of time. Normally, both the distance traveled and the speed of the lead and remote locomotives will, on average, be the same since they are in the same train. If there is a separation, however, both the distance traveled and the speed of the lead and remote locomotives will be different to the extent that there is a train separation. By comparing the speed and distance traveled of the lead and remote locomotives, the distributed power system will be able to detect train separation and take appropriate action.

    Abstract: A radio selective calling receiver which can improve the precision of a timepiece up to the clock precision of a reception signal from a base station is provided. A bit synchronization section establishes bit synchronization of a digital signal from a reception section to output a reproduction clock. A frequency divider for a timepiece function frequency-divides a reference clock with insufficient precision, which is supplied from a reference clock generation section, by a fixed value while the digital signal is in a frame step-out state. While the digital signal is in a frame synchronized state, the frequency divider variably frequency-divides the reference clock by using a phase correction signal for correcting an internal phase advance/delay, which is output from the bit synchronization section, thereby correcting a gain/loss in time displayed on a display section.

    Abstract: A multilayer printed circuit board has a substrate, an inner interconnection layer formed on each surface of the substrate, and an outer interconnection layer overlying each inner interconnection layer. The inner interconnection layer is formed of a copper sheet and two latticed metal films made of a metal having a low thermal expansion coefficient and bonded to boty surfaces of the copper sheet under application of pressure. The area ratio of exposed portions of the copper sheet to the whole surface of the interconnection layer is between 25 and 75%. Thermal expansion coefficient of the resultant circuit board is lowered to be close to the thermal expansion coefficient of a LSI, thereby obtaining reliability of a electronic product due to a low thermal stress. The metallic film is made of Kovar or Invar.

    Abstract: Memory access latency is reduced by storage of additional pages of a block together with storage protection keys in a cache memory. When a miss occurs for a particular address and/or a corresponding storage protection key in an address translation look-aside buffer, other storage protection keys for other pages of the same block containing the page causing the miss are associatively accessed from a multi-page key cache. Thus, pages which do not have addresses or storage protection keys stored in the translation look-aside buffer but which are locally stored in a cache may have the storage protection keys provided locally with short access time and without communication over a network.

    Abstract: Proton sponge, berberine, and cetyltrimethyl ammonium hydroxide base compounds are used as additives to chemically amplified photoresists based on modified polyhydroxystyrene (PHS). The base additives scavenge free acids from the photoresist in order to preserve the acid labile moieties on the modified PHS polymer. The base additives are well suited to industrial processing conditions, do not react with the photoacid compounds in the photoresist composition to form byproducts which would hinder photoresist performance, and extend the shelf-life of the photoresist composition. In addition, the proton sponge and berberine base additives have a different absorption spectra than the modified PHS polymer, therefore, the quantity of base additive within the photoresist can be easily assayed and controlled.
